GIVE ME SOME AIRAdobe Integrated Runtime (formely code named Apollo). As you can see, the new name is Adobe AIR, like the extension that is used when you deploy AIR applications. A few highlites:

  • native OS drag and drop support
  • support for multi-windowed applications
  • complete rendering support for HTML content (webkit engine)
  • integration of a local database engine (SQLite)

Also announced today is the Flex 3 beta. This beta realease really looks very cool:

  • a dramatic reduction in the size of SWF files (flex framewor has to been downloaded ones per user)
  • a number of refactoring operations that work across ActionScript and MXML added
  • integration with CS3 (import skins made in CS3)
  • support for AIR
